    Reply from Tony

    ..........................


    Hi Patrick, Thanks for your information. I have updated 2.2.0.177 to 2.2.0.184 on 2016/5/26. Please download and install the latest version first, thanks. Here

    1, Ahhhh, I'm on Win7HP x64... I've got a folder on D drive, with only Visible ticked. Explorer is not in the list of exception applications I try to access the folder in Explorer, and I cannot, even after I input Admin password. I can see it, but that is all. Maybe it's a Win10 issue?

    A: If only Visible ticked, then this file will be visible but not accessible, that is the way EFL works. To make the file accessible, please keep Accessible ticked too.

    2, Something's wrong with this new version. Well maybe. After upgrading from 2.1 to 2.2 now one of my exception applications is not able to write to the disk.

    A: After upgrading from 2.1 to 2.2, all the exception applications need to be reconfigured depends on per file.

    3, SyncBackFree is set as Exclusion Application. It was working fine on v2.1 but yesterday I upgraded directly without uninstall v2.1 and now SyncBackFree can't write to my protected disk (UFD).

    A: EFL can't recognize the process running before EFL installation is finished, so SyncBackFree needs to be restarted after the installation is finished. also all the exception applications need to be reconfigured after the installation is finished. To make SyncBackFree work, the checkbox of SyncBackFree in the Exception Applications list should be kept ticked. Best regards, Tony
